A POCSO (protection of children from sexual offences act) court on Wednesday awarded a tripe life-term to a man who was found guilty of raping and murdering a seven-year-old girl two years ago in Kollam, South Kerala. Rajesh, (27), was found guilty by the court on Monday.

Delivering the quantum of punishment, the court said he was spared the death sentence considering his age. But he has to undergo three life terms and an additional jail term of 26 years. The court also observed that all three life terms will have to be served separately. He was sentenced under charges of rape, murder, abduction, unnatural sex, showing disrespect to body and destroying evidence.

The shocking incident occurred in September 2017. Rajesh was the uncle of the victim. According to the prosecution, when her grandmother was taking the girl to school they met Rajesh on the way and he offered to drop her to school. After being assured that he would drop her to school, the grandmother returned home. Instead of taking her to school, the prosecution said, he took the girl to a rubber plantation in his auto-rickshaw. After raping her brutally he strangulated her, according to the prosecution. Her body was recovered two days after she was reported missing.

Though the prosecution sought the death penalty, the judge observed that after considering the age of the convict he was excused from the death penalty. The case had triggered shock and outrage in the state in 2017.
